The BBC delivered a solid, if cheap, adaption of John Wyndham's novel; well ahead of the previous movie. Certainly the effects are well below Hollywood standards, even of that era, and a certain amount of expensive story-telling is handled off-camera, but the acting is convincing and the story is well told. My only real complaint is that occasionally I felt that there were some rather sudden changes of character, but there's only so much you can do in a mini-series.
